Ecosyste.ms: Awesome

An open API service indexing awesome lists of open source software.

Awesome Lists | Featured Topics | Projects

https://github.com/murggu/awesome-synapse

A curated list of awesome Azure Synapse resources
https://github.com/murggu/awesome-synapse

List: awesome-synapse

awesome awesome-list azure azure-synapse azure-synapse-analytics lists resources synapse

Last synced: about 1 month ago
JSON representation

A curated list of awesome Azure Synapse resources

Awesome Lists containing this project

README

        

# awesome-synapse

A collection of awesome Synapse libraries, resources and shiny things.

> Ideas? Contributions? Bugs? If you'd like to add more resources or you run into any issues, feel free to create a [pull request](https://github.com/murggu/awesome-synapse/pulls) or [open an issue](https://github.com/murggu/awesome-synapse/issues) in this repository.

## Repositories

### Tools & Samples

- [Azure-Samples/Synapse](https://github.com/Azure-Samples/Synapse) - Samples for Azure Synapse Analytics.
- [Azure-Samples/sample-mdw-serverless](https://github.com/Azure-Samples/sample-mdw-serverless) - End-to-end sample using Power BI, Synapse Serverless and Pipelines.
- [Azure/DW-with-Synapse-Data-Factory-Power-BI](https://github.com/Azure/DW-with-Synapse-Data-Factory-Power-BI) - Create a data mart using ADF, Synapse and Power BI.
- [Azure/Test-Drive-Azure-Synapse-with-a-1-click-POC](https://github.com/Azure/Test-Drive-Azure-Synapse-with-a-1-click-POC) - POC with pre-populated dataset, pipeline, notebook.
- [Azure/Test-Drive-Synapse-Link-For-DataVerse](https://github.com/Azure/Test-Drive-Synapse-Link-For-DataVerse) - POC environment of Azure Synapse Analytics link for Dataverse with Spark notebooks.
- [Azure/dataverse-to-sql](https://github.com/Azure/dataverse-to-sql) - DataverseToSql tool.
- [Azure/azure-kusto-trender](https://github.com/Azure/azure-kusto-trender) - A JS client for Kusto, including Synapse Data Explorer.
- [Azure/Azure-Orbital-Analytics-Samples](https://github.com/Azure/Azure-Orbital-Analytics-Samples) - Spaceborne data analysis with Azure Synapse Analytics.
- [microsoft/hyperspace](https://github.com/microsoft/hyperspace) - An indexing subsystem that brings index-based query acceleration to Apache Spark.
- [microsoft/SynapseML](https://github.com/microsoft/SynapseML) - Distributed ML framework built on Apache Spark.
- [microsoft/sql-server-samples](https://github.com/microsoft/sql-server-samples) - Azure Data SQL Samples, including Synapse.
- [microsoft/Azure_Synapse_Toolbox](https://github.com/microsoft/Azure_Synapse_Toolbox) - Tools/queries for managing and monitoring Azure Synapse.
- [microsoft/AzureSynapseScriptsAndAccelerators](https://github.com/microsoft/AzureSynapseScriptsAndAccelerators) - Assessment scripts and on-prem DWs migration into Azure Synapse.
- [microsoft/synapse-support](https://github.com/microsoft/synapse-support) - Public-facing support-driven content for Azure Synapse Analytics.
- [microsoft/azure-synapse-spark-metrics](https://github.com/microsoft/azure-synapse-spark-metrics) - Easy metrics monitoring functions for Synapse.
- [microsoft/BackupDwToBlob](https://github.com/microsoft/BackupDwToBlob) - Backup SQL Pool to Azure Blob Storage using ADF.
- [microsoft/AzureSynapseEndToEndDemo](https://github.com/microsoft/AzureSynapseEndToEndDemo) - Azure Synapse end-to-end demo.
- [microsoft/Azure-Analytics-and-AI-Engagement](https://github.com/microsoft/Azure-Analytics-and-AI-Engagement) - Microsoft Dream Demo in a Box
- [microsoft/SynapseGenie](https://github.com/microsoft/SynapseGenie) - Run multiple notebooks in the same Spark pool.
- [AasTrailblazers/AzureSynapse](https://github.com/AasTrailblazers/AzureSynapse) - Spark and SQL pool examples.
- [abhirockzz/cosmosdb-synapse-workshop](https://github.com/abhirockzz/cosmosdb-synapse-workshop) - Azure Synapse Link for Azure Cosmos DB example.
- [AdamPaternostro/Azure-Synapse-SQL-Serverless-Generate-From-Hive](https://github.com/AdamPaternostro/Azure-Synapse-SQL-Serverless-Generate-From-Hive) - Generate SQL Serverless create view statements from Hive.
- [AdamPaternostro/Azure-SQL-DW-Synapse-Test-Case-Runner](https://github.com/AdamPaternostro/Azure-SQL-DW-Synapse-Test-Case-Runner) - Tool for running test cases on Synapse.
- [bretamyers/Azure-Synapse-Lakehouse-Sync](https://github.com/bretamyers/Azure-Synapse-Lakehouse-Sync) - Lakehouse sync tool.
- [datahai/serverlesssqlpooltools](https://github.com/datahai/serverlesssqlpooltools) - SQL scripts for Azure Synapse Analytics Serverless SQL Pools.
- [dbt-msft/dbt-synapse](https://github.com/dbt-msft/dbt-synapse) - dbt adapter for Synapse Dedicated SQL Pools.
- [edkreuk/DataIntegration/tree/main/Azure-Synapse-Analytics/Templates](https://github.com/edkreuk/DataIntegration/tree/main/Azure-Synapse-Analytics/Templates) - Templates for Synapse Pipelines.
- [kevchant/AzureDevOps-SynapseServerlessSQLPool](https://github.com/kevchant/AzureDevOps-SynapseServerlessSQLPool) - Template to perform CI/CD for Azure Synapse Serverless SQL Pools using ADO.
- [kevchant/AzureDevOps-AzureSynapseSQLPool](https://github.com/kevchant/AzureDevOps-AzureSynapseSQLPool) - Template to perform CI/CD for Azure Synapse dedicated SQL Pools using ADO.
- [markprycemaher/Synapse](https://github.com/markprycemaher/Synapse) - Scripts and tools for Azure Synapse SQL Pools / SQL-On-Demand (Serverless).
- [mrpaulandrew/procfwk](https://github.com/mrpaulandrew/procfwk) - Metadata driven processing framework for ADF and Synapse.
- [mrpaulandrewltd/Azure-Data-Integration-Pipeline-Training](https://github.com/mrpaulandrewltd/Azure-Data-Integration-Pipeline-Training) - Training workshop content on ADF and Synapse Pipelines.
- [PacktPublishing/Limitless-Analytics-with-Azure-Synapse](https://github.com/PacktPublishing/Limitless-Analytics-with-Azure-Synapse) - Samples of the book Limitless Analytics with Azure Synapse.
- [PacktPublishing/Azure-Synapse-Analytics-cookbook](https://github.com/PacktPublishing/Azure-Synapse-Analytics-cookbook) - Samples for the book Azure Synapse Analytics Cookbook.
- [rebremer/azure-synapseserverless-python-rest-api](https://github.com/rebremer/azure-synapseserverless-python-rest-api) - Create a REST API with Python on Synapse Serverless pools using external tables.
- [santiagxf/synapse-cicd](https://github.com/santiagxf/synapse-cicd) - GitHub Actions/ADO based CI/CD workflow for Azure Synapse or Azure SQL Database.
- [solliancenet/azure-synapse-analytics-day](https://github.com/solliancenet/azure-synapse-analytics-day) - Azure Synapse Analytics in a Day Lab.
- [solliancenet/azure-synapse-analytics-workshop-400](https://github.com/solliancenet/azure-synapse-analytics-workshop-400) - Azure Synapse Analtytics Workshop L400.
- [solliancenet/azure-synapse-analytics-ga-content-packs](https://github.com/solliancenet/azure-synapse-analytics-ga-content-packs) - Readiness content packs for Synapse.

### Deployment Templates

- [Azure/azure-synapse-analytics-end2end](https://github.com/Azure/azure-synapse-analytics-end2end) - Deployment Accelerator using Bicep.
- [Azure/Synapse-workspace-deployment](https://github.com/Azure/Synapse-workspace-deployment) - GitHub action for Synapse.
- [murggu/azure-synapse-terraform](https://github.com/murggu/azure-synapse-terraform) - Secure Synapse Terraform templates.
- [quickstarts/microsoft.synapse/synapse-poc](https://github.com/Azure/azure-quickstart-templates/tree/da0cdd93d7dd7d842c9c7e89738d4682c8013495/quickstarts/microsoft.synapse/synapse-poc) - Synapse ARM templates.
- [shaneochotny/Azure-Synapse-Analytics-PoC](https://github.com/shaneochotny/Azure-Synapse-Analytics-PoC) - Synapse Bicep and Terraform templates.
- [SQLPlayer/azure.synapse.tools](https://github.com/SQLPlayer/azure.synapse.tools) - PowerShell module to deploy Synapse.

### Benchmarks

- [rawatsudhir1/AzureSynapseDWH](https://github.com/rawatsudhir1/AzureSynapseDWH) - Scripts from [this techcommunity blog post](https://techcommunity.microsoft.com/t5/azure-synapse-analytics-blog/performance-benchmark-azure-synapse-analytics-data-warehouse/ba-p/1381302)

### Solution Accelerators

- [microsoft/Azure-Synapse-Solution-Accelerator-Commodity-Price-Prediction](https://github.com/microsoft/Azure-Synapse-Solution-Accelerator-Commodity-Price-Prediction) - Commodity Price Prediction Solution Accelerator.
- [microsoft/Azure-Synapse-Solution-Accelerator-Customer-Revenue-Growth-Factor](https://github.com/microsoft/Azure-Synapse-Solution-Accelerator-Financial-Analytics-Customer-Revenue-Growth-Factor) - Customer Revenue Growth Factor Solution Accelerator.
- [microsoft/Azure-Synapse-Content-Recommendations-Solution-Accelerator](https://github.com/microsoft/Azure-Synapse-Content-Recommendations-Solution-Accelerator) - Content recommentations Solution Accelerator.
- [microsoft/Azure-Synapse-Retail-Recommender-Solution-Accelerator](https://github.com/microsoft/Azure-Synapse-Retail-Recommender-Solution-Accelerator) - Retail Recommender Solution Accelerator.
- [microsoft/Azure-Synapse-Customer-Insights-Customer360-Solution-Accelerator](https://github.com/microsoft/Azure-Synapse-Customer-Insights-Customer360-Solution-Accelerator) - Customer Insights Customer 360 Solution Accelerator.
- [microsoft/Azure-Synapse-Solution-Accelerator--Part-Comparator](https://github.com/microsoft/Azure-Synapse-Solution-Accelerator--Part-Comparator) - Part Comparator Solution Accelerator.
- [microsoft/Relationship-Mesh-Solution-Accelerator-with-MGDC-and-Azure-Synapse-Analytics](https://github.com/microsoft/Relationship-Mesh-Solution-Accelerator-with-MGDC-and-Azure-Synapse-Analytics) - Relationship Mesh Solution Accelerator.
- [ROBROICH/AZURE_SYNAPSE_AND_SAP_SFLIGHT_DEMO](https://github.com/ROBROICH/AZURE_SYNAPSE_AND_SAP_SFLIGHT_DEMO) - Synapse + SAP SFLIGHT demo.

## Other Resources

### Docs

- [Azure Synapse - Official docs](https://learn.microsoft.com/en-us/azure/synapse-analytics/guidance/success-by-design-introduction)
- [Azure Synapse - Blog](https://techcommunity.microsoft.com/t5/azure-synapse-analytics-blog/bg-p/AzureSynapseAnalyticsBlog)
- [Azure Synapse - Monthly update](https://techcommunity.microsoft.com/t5/azure-synapse-analytics-blog/bg-p/AzureSynapseAnalyticsBlog/label-name/Monthly%20Update)
- [Azure Synapse - Success by design](https://learn.microsoft.com/en-us/azure/synapse-analytics/guidance/success-by-design-introduction)
- [Azure Synapse - Reference Architectures](https://learn.microsoft.com/en-us/azure/architecture/browse/?terms=Synapse)

### Community

- [Azure Synapse - Community](https://azure.github.io/Synapse/)
- [Azure Synapse - Influencer Program](https://azure.github.io/Synapse/influencers/)
- [Azure Synapse - Twitter](https://twitter.com/Azure_Synapse)
- [Azure Synapse on Medium](https://medium.com/tag/azure-synapse-analytics)

### Learning

- [Azure Synapse - Learning paths and modules](https://learn.microsoft.com/en-us/training/browse/?expanded=azure&products=azure-synapse-analytics)
- [Synapse Practitioner](https://azure.microsoft.com/en-us/resources/developers/synapse-analytics-for-data-engineers/)
- [Microsoft Virtual Training Days](https://mvtd.events.microsoft.com/?azureevent=Microsoft%20Azure%20Virtual%20Training%20Day:%20Deliver%20Integrated%20Analytics%20with%20Azure%20Synapse)
- [30-Day Cloud Skills Challenge](https://learn.microsoft.com/en-us/training/challenges?id=3d6cb3b9-f4b7-4d7b-ab23-57faa1762705&wt.mc_id=cloudskillschallenge_3d6cb3b9-f4b7-4d7b-ab23-57faa1762705)
- [Get Started with Azure Synapse Analytics in 60 Minutes](https://info.microsoft.com/ww-landing-get-started-with-azure-synapse-analytics-in-60-minutes.html)
- YouTube →
- [Azure Synapse - YouTube channel](https://www.youtube.com/channel/UCsZ4IlYjjVxqe5OZ14tyh5g)
- [Guy in a Cube - YouTube channel](https://www.youtube.com/c/GuyinaCube)
- [Pragmatic Works - YouTube channel](https://www.youtube.com/c/PragmaticWorks)
- [Advancing Analytics (The Synapse Sessions) - YouTube channel](https://www.youtube.com/playlist?list=PLHN2ijxAWBaMl5Bl1KlLpGx-uend0WHP0)
- [Datahai BI (Synapse Analytics) - YouTube channel](https://www.youtube.com/playlist?list=PL4dsvcj_pgQZLPHM9RIUmdYlbNDn5agc6)
- LinkedIn →
- [Microsoft Azure Synapse for Developers - LinkedIn Learning](https://www.linkedin.com/learning/microsoft-azure-synapse-for-developers-14246261/data-warehouses-in-the-cloud)
- [Microsoft Azure Synapse for Developers: Scaling Configuration - LinkedIn Learning](https://www.linkedin.com/learning/microsoft-azure-synapse-for-developers-scaling-configuration/configuring-azure-synapse-workspaces)

### Technical Discussions and Q&A

- [Azure Synapse on StackOverflow](https://stackoverflow.com/questions/tagged/azure-synapse+or+azure-synapse+or+azure-sql-data-warehouse)
- [Azure Synapse on Microsoft Q&A](https://feedback.azure.com/d365community/forum/9b9ba8e4-0825-ec11-b6e6-000d3a4f07b8)

### Books

- [Azure Synapse Analytics Cookbook](https://www.packtpub.com/product/azure-synapse-analytics-cookbook/9781803231501) by Gaurav Agarwal, Meenakshi Muralidharan
- [Limitless Analytics with Azure Synapse](https://www.packtpub.com/product/limitless-analytics-with-azure-synapse/9781800205659) By Prashant Kumar Mishra
- [Learning Azure Synapse Analytics](https://www.oreilly.com/library/view/learning-azure-synapse/9781098127688/) by Paul Andrew, Richard Swinbank

### Research Papers

- [POLARIS: the distributed SQL engine in Azure Synapse](https://www.microsoft.com/research/publication/polaris-the-distributed-sql-engine-in-azure-synapse/)
- [Windows Azure Storage: Highly available cloud storage with strong consistency](https://azure.microsoft.com/blog/sosp-paper-windows-azure-storage-a-highly-available-cloud-storage-service-with-strong-consistency/)
- [Split query processing in polybase](https://www.microsoft.com/research/publication/split-query-processing-in-polybase/)
- [Query optimization in Microsoft SQL Server PDW](https://www.microsoft.com/en-us/research/publication/query-optimization-in-microsoft-sql-server-pdw/)

Azure Synapse 💙 Community